Description
Abiraterone is an anticancer chemotherapeutic compound that is used to treat castration-resistant prostate cancer. Abiratone inhibits the enzyme Cytochrome p450 17α-hydroxylase (Cyp17), reducing androgen production. This compound may also directly decrease levels of androgen receptor protein expression and inhibit eIF4F signaling.
